1. Foundations: The Transformer Breakthrough (2017)

The journey of ChatGPT starts with the groundbreaking research paper “Attention Is All You Need” in 2017, which introduced the transformer architecture. This innovation laid the foundation for language models to understand context more efficiently than traditional RNNs or LSTMs.


2. Birth of GPT Models

  • GPT-1 (2018): OpenAI’s first generative model trained on a massive corpus of text data using unsupervised learning. While small by today’s standards, GPT-1 was a proof of concept.

  • GPT-2 (2019): With 1.5 billion parameters, GPT-2 was capable of writing coherent essays, stories, and even poetry. OpenAI initially hesitated to release it due to concerns about misuse.

  • GPT-3 (2020): A game-changer with 175 billion parameters, GPT-3 amazed the world with its ability to mimic human-like responses, sparking massive adoption in apps, plugins, and businesses.


3. ChatGPT: A Conversational Revolution (2022)

While GPT-3 was impressive, it wasn’t optimized for dialogue. In late 2022, OpenAI released ChatGPT, based on a fine-tuned version of GPT-3.5 using Reinforcement Learning from Human Feedback (RLHF). This made it more reliable, safe, and interactive in conversations.


4. The Arrival of GPT-4 (2023)

With the launch of GPT-4, ChatGPT became smarter, more creative, and capable of handling images, code, and multi-step reasoning. It also improved memory features and contextual continuity in conversations.
